  • Publication number: 20230404424
    Abstract: A minimally invasive surgical instrument using 3-axis magnetic positioning, system and methods thereof. This invention describes two key ideas that enable the development of a magnetic position system based on integrated anisotropic magnetoresistive (AMR) magnetic field sensors. This achieves the resolution, power and area targets necessary to integrate 3 axes anisotropic magnetoresistance (AMR) sensors along with the Analog Front End integrated circuit (IC) in a 4 mm by 350 um integrated solution for catheter applications. The stringent area and power dissipation requirements are met by development through both system level solutions for higher field strengths and a minimally necessary Analog Front End (AFE) to meet the 1 mm rms resolution requirement in the power dissipation and area budget.

  • Patent number: 9689903
    Abstract: In an embodiment, a body of apparatus includes an opening, such as a V-shaped jaw, that deterministically locates a position of a wire in at least one dimension when the wire is placed in the opening. The apparatus also includes a plurality of sensors. At least one differential signal can be generated from signals from magnetic sensors, such as anisotropic magnetoresistance (AMR) sensors, of the plurality of sensors to cancel out common mode interference. An additional sensor of the plurality of sensors provides an output from which the location of the wire in another dimension is determined. The current flowing through the wire can be derived from at least the at least one differential signal and the location of the wire the other dimension.
